Data Strategy, Governance, & Management
Data strategy and governance are critical for your organization to ensure data quality, consistency, and security. They’re also vital for meeting regulatory requirements, enabling application scalability, and enhancing accountability and efficiency.
We help clients craft their organization’s data strategy and governance rules using a well-established framework and methodology that include:
Benchmarking data maturity and assessing internal capabilities
Assessing data quality, integrity, consistency, and completeness
Designing and implementing a data governance model (data structure, stakeholders, policies, MDM/lineage)
Cataloging, characterizing, and prioritizing business use cases

Employee Account Risk Analytics
Employee accounts at financial institutions present additional fraud and abuse risks beyond those for a typical account. Employees have access to internal systems, knowledge of business practices, and, in some cases, the ability to circumvent or override existing internal controls. Employee Account Risk Analytics can monitor your employee accounts to help identify red flags consistent with fraud and abuse.

Regulatory Compliance
Regulatory compliance can be a challenge, especially when it requires data analysis in a difficult format, such as text files. Often, these files were created to log activity and not designed for mass analysis. We can help wrangle and analyze this data. We’ve assisted clients in responding to regulatory pressures in several ways:
Analyzing NSFs that meet certain fact patterns, such as multiple representments or positive authorization with negative settlement
Comparing data between disparate systems to help identify gaps
Applying business logic to transaction histories to recalculate what should have happened to help rectify miscalculations and make customers whole
The manufacturing and distribution environment can house tremendous amounts of data across many disparate systems. From production details to bill of materials tracking, route mapping, customer data, and typical financial reporting, our analytics professionals can help put that data to work for you. Our team utilizes a robust methodology to help transform that data into actionable analyses for our clients.
Solutions can include:
Cash Flow Forecasting
Building 13-week cash flow rollers to assist C-Suite teams in managing the timing of cash flows.
Cost Accounting Assistance
Assisting manufacturers with a variety of cost accounting issues.
Data Cube Builds
Assisting transaction advisory teams with building a single transactional database within the historical period being subjected to diligence procedures.
Labor Analysis
Computing contribution margin by individual direct employee. Also performing efficiency analysis at the individual direct employee level.
Production Line Analysis
Projecting contribution margin by line/department based on actual results and theoretical engineering standards.
Scenario Analysis
Assisting manufacturing CFOs with a variety of what-if scenario analyses related to production, expansion, contraction, and spin-offs.
SKU Margin Analysis
SKU level contribution margin analysis, either standard or actual costing, presented in segmentation views (by customer, region, product type, end market, etc.).

Apportionment Analysis
Our State Tax Apportionment tool helps companies automate their state tax apportionment based upon the tax filing methods and apportionment rules specific to each state and operational structure. Controlled by the user, this convenient resource allows on-demand processing and reporting, including the ability for scenario planning. It also features key reports and data visualizations for audit details and analytics.
Book to Tax Analysis
Our Taxable Income Automation tool helps companies automate their taxable income computation based upon their trial balance structure(s) and specific tax adjustments. Controlled by the user, this convenient resource allows on-demand processing and reporting, including the ability to customize the interface with tax compliance and provision software(s) in use. It also features key reports and data visualizations for audit details and analytics.
Sales & Use Tax
Processing monthly sales data across the various states your organization operates in can be complex and time-consuming. Our Sales & Use Tax tool will examine your sales data and interface with popular tax engines like Vertex to help verify your sales tax returns are accurate and filed on time.
SALT Nexus & Exposure Analysis
Each state has different rules and thresholds regarding when a company is required to file state tax returns. Through our analytics, we help identify the state(s) in which a client has nexus and establish whether they’re required to file state tax returns.
Transfer Pricing Analysis
This tool helps companies manage expense allocations to their foreign subsidiaries and affiliates. Users can build rules to drive allocations from multiple corporate headquarters across all entities, as well as generate data to drive intercompany invoices. Interactive dashboards can help you to see year-over-year and quarter-over-quarter trends and view advanced analytics from allocating entities, as well as receiving entities.
